Job Title: Data Governance Manager


Location: Hyderabad, India


Employment Type: full-time


The job


As a Data Governance Manager, you will leverage your expertise to drive excellence in the following key areas:


  • Data Governance Leadership: Serve as a trusted expert in data governance, providing strategic guidance and fostering best practices throughout the data governance lifecycle.


  • Stakeholder Collaboration: Partner with stakeholders to ensure the adoption of organizational standards, adherence to governance policies and procedures, and the implementation of a structured process for managing changes, promoting accountability and ownership.


  • Consistency and Compliance: Lead recurring data governance reviews to ensure consistency, alignment, and adherence to governance standards across platforms and systems.


Key responsibilities


Establish Governance Frameworks: Develop and implement data governance policies, standards, and procedures to ensure data quality, security, and compliance.
Collaborate with Stakeholders: Engage with cross-functional teams to drive the adoption of data governance practices, promote accountability, and ensure alignment with organizational objectives.
Monitor and Review Compliance: Conduct regular audits and reviews to maintain consistency and adherence to data governance standards across systems and processes.
Foster a Data-Driven Culture: Provide training and guidance to stakeholders, empowering teams to effectively manage and utilize data while adhering to governance principles.


Essential requirements


Collaborate with business stakeholders to identify critical data elements and ensure that they are properly managed throughout their lifecycle.


• Design and implement data quality monitoring and reporting processes to ensure that data remains accurate and consistent.


• Work with IT teams to establish data standards and guidelines for data management and use.


• Identify and manage data risks and issues, working with relevant stakeholders to resolve them.


• Develop and deliver training programs to promote data governance best practices across the organization.


• Monitor/report on metrics and KPIs to track the effectiveness of data governance initiatives.


• Stay current with industry developments in data governance and compliance.


Desired skills


Utilization of tools such as Informatica, SQL Server, Power BI or other tools for viewing, profiling, querying, and analyzing data from multiple data sources.


Develop, implement, and maintain data governance policies and procedures, ensuring that they are aligned with industry best practices and regulatory requirements.
